Key Takeaways

  • โ—

    Psychologists in Canada earn 33% more than in Japan (nominal USD).

  • โ—

    After adjusting for purchasing power (PPP), Japan actually leads by 15%.

  • โ—

    Using the Big Mac Index, a Psychologist's salary buys 1.4x more Big Macs in Japan.
